微信小游戏显示运行内存不足闪退什么原因呢

 2026-03-31  阅读 130  评论 0

摘要:当手机屏幕上突然弹出“运行内存不足”的提示,微信小游戏瞬间闪退,就像一位突然被关进小黑屋的朋友——它明明刚刚还在活蹦乱跳,转眼间却消失得无影无踪。这种突如其来的"中场休息",其实是手机内存空间、游戏程

当手机屏幕上突然弹出“运行内存不足”的提示,微信小游戏瞬间闪退,就像一位突然被关进小黑屋的朋友——它明明刚刚还在活蹦乱跳,转眼间却消失得无影无踪。这种突如其来的"中场休息",其实是手机内存空间、游戏程序与微信系统三方博弈的结果。想要破解这个数字谜题,我们需要掀开手机后台的幕布,看看那些躲在系统深处的"内存争夺战"。

微信小游戏显示运行内存不足闪退什么原因呢

硬件性能的天花板

每部手机都像拥有不同容积的"记忆口袋"。当搭载老旧处理器的设备运行3D渲染小游戏时,就像让小学生搬运集装箱——即便微信程序本身仅占用300MB内存,但游戏场景加载、物理引擎计算等隐形任务会让内存需求瞬间膨胀。特别是当设备物理内存小于4GB时,后台微信程序、系统服务、其他常驻应用早已瓜分了大部分内存空间,留给游戏的生存空间自然所剩无几。

游戏开发的优化陷阱

有些小游戏开发者为了追求炫目效果,在场景中堆砌了过多高清贴图与粒子特效。这些看似酷炫的设计,就像在狭小的房间里塞满家具——当游戏场景切换时,未被及时释放的临时内存会像漏气的气球般不断膨胀。更有甚者采用"内存预加载"策略,在启动时就占用数百MB内存储备,这种"先占为王"的策略在低端设备上极易触发系统强制清理机制。

微信生态的特殊规则

作为运行载体,微信小程序框架本身就像严格的舞台监督。它不仅为每个小游戏划分了专用"隔离舱",还设置了动态内存。当监测到某个游戏占用超过总内存的60%(通常在1.2GB左右),就会启动"紧急逃生程序"。这种设计本是为保障微信主程序稳定运行,但在多任务切换场景下,用户可能刚切出游戏回个消息,回来就发现舞台已被强制清场。

后台程序的暗战

手机后台潜伏着许多"内存吸血鬼"。定位服务持续扫描基站信号,云同步程序在偷偷上传照片,就连天气小组件都在定时刷新数据。这些看似无害的功能,就像无数小触手不断蚕食内存空间。当用户从其他应用切换回微信时,系统可能已将这些"休眠"进程重新激活,留给小游戏的可用内存就像被挤扁的三明治。

缓存数据的隐形负担

微信本体就像个恋旧的收藏家,聊天图片、短视频缓存、小程序临时文件都被它仔细收在"记忆阁楼"里。这些看似零碎的文件,经年累月可能堆积成数百MB的"记忆废墟"。当用户连续游玩多个小游戏时,每个游戏产生的临时缓存都像在阁楼里添置新家具,最终让整个空间变得拥挤不堪。

系统调度的版本差异

不同安卓版本对内存管理有着截然不同的"性格"。安卓8.0以下的系统像粗心的管家,放任后台程序随意占位;而安卓12引入的"冻结进程"功能,则像突然断电的舞台灯光,可能误伤正在运行的小游戏。iOS系统虽然调度更精准,但当剩余内存低于10%时,也会化身铁面无情的清道夫。

当小游戏再次因内存不足退场时,不妨给手机来次深度清洁:关闭无用的后台进程,定期清理微信缓存,关闭游戏中的高清选项。就像整理凌乱的房间,合理的空间规划能让每个程序都找到舒适的位置。而对于开发者而言,在追求视觉效果与保持轻量化之间找到平衡,才是让游戏常驻用户手机的最佳策略。毕竟在这个移动互联时代,谁能在有限的内存里创造无限的乐趣,谁就能赢得用户的持久青睐。

版权声明: 知妳网保留所有权利,部分内容为网络收集,如有侵权,请联系QQ793061840删除,添加请注明来意。

原文链接:https://www.6g9.cn/bkkp/dd23dAz5ZUFVaAA.html

发表评论:

关于我们
知妳网是一个专注于知识成长与生活品质的温暖社区,致力于提供情感共鸣、实用资讯与贴心服务。在这里,妳可以找到相关的知识、专业的建议,以及提升自我的优质内容。无论是职场困惑、情感心事,还是时尚美妆、健康生活,知妳网都能精准匹配妳的需求,陪伴妳的每一步成长。因为懂妳,所以更贴心——知妳网,做妳最知心的伙伴!
联系方式
电话:
地址:广东省中山市
Email:admin@qq.com

Copyright © 2022 知妳网 Inc. 保留所有权利。 Powered by

页面耗时0.0578秒, 内存占用1.71 MB, 访问数据库19次